Hva er smarte kontrakter?

Hva er smarte kontrakter?

Begrepet smart kontrakt kastes ofte rundt i teknologiverdenen, spesielt når vi snakker om kryptokurver. Begrepet brukes hovedsakelig for å beskrive datakode som automatisk utfører alle eller deler av en avtale lagret på en blockchain.





Likevel kan smarte kontrakter være mye mer rudimentære, og selv om de er smarte, er de egentlig ikke intelligente og bruker ikke AI. Så, hva er smarte kontrakter? Og hvordan fungerer de?





Hva er smarte kontrakter?

Begrepet ble brukt for første gang på 1990 -tallet av datavitenskapsmann og kryptograf Nick Szabo.





I artikkelen hans Smarte kontrakter: Byggeklosser for digitale markeder , Beskriver Szabo smarte kontrakter som nye institusjoner, og nye måter å formalisere disse institusjonene […] […] på som muliggjort av den digitale revolusjonen. Han kaller dem smarte på grunn av deres høyere funksjonalitet enn deres papirbaserte forfedre, mens han understreker at ingen bruk av kunstig intelligens er underforstått.

Faktisk er det mest grunnleggende eksemplet på en smart kontrakt en automat. Når en kjøper oppfyller betingelsene i kontrakten ved å sette penger inn i maskinen, respekterer den automatisk vilkårene i avtalen og snur produktet. Selvfølgelig brukes mer sofistikerte former for smarte kontrakter for utveksling av blockchain-baserte kryptokurver.



stoppkode dårlig systemkonfigurasjonsinformasjon

Szabo fortsetter med å definere smarte kontrakter som et sett med løfter, spesifisert i digital form, inkludert protokoller som partene utfører på disse løftene.

Relatert: Hva er Ethereum og hvordan fungerer det?





Hvordan fungerer smarte kontrakter?

For øyeblikket er smarte kontrakter best egnet for to typer transaksjoner som finnes i mange kontrakter: å sørge for at en betaling foretas når bestemte vilkår er oppfylt og ilegge økonomiske straffer hvis visse betingelser ikke er oppfylt.

I slekt: De 4 beste kryptohandelsappene på Android Som sådan er deres hovedfunksjon å utføre visse bestemmelser, for eksempel å overføre penger fra en parts lommebok til en annen. Med andre ord, hvis x skjer, blir trinn y utført som et svar. Deretter replikeres selve smartkontrakten gjennom flere blockchain -noder, og drar nytte av sikkerheten og immutabiliteten som blockchain tilbyr.





Hvor smarte er smarte kontrakter?

Szabos beslutning om å markere at smarte kontrakter faktisk ikke er intelligente, er svært viktig. Smarte kontrakter kan være smartere enn deres papirbaserte kolleger, og kan utføre noen forhåndsprogrammerte trinn automatisk, men de kan fortsatt ikke analysere en kontrakts mer subjektive bestemmelser.

Dette betyr at oppgavene smarte kontrakter faktisk kan utføre er ganske rudimentære. Selv om smarte kontrakter vil bli mer komplekse og i stand til å takle sofistikerte transaksjoner etter hvert som adopsjonen av blockchain -teknologien sprer seg, er vi fortsatt mange år unna smarte kontrakter som bestemmer subjektive juridiske kriterier.

Dele Dele kvitring E -post Bitcoin er treg: Hva er den raskeste kryptovalutaen?

Du vil sende litt kryptovaluta, men hva er den raskeste måten å gjøre det på?

Les neste
Relaterte temaer
  • Teknologi forklart
  • Ethereum
  • Blockchain
  • Fremtiden for penger
Om forfatteren Toin Villar(17 artikler publisert)

Toin er en bachelorstudent med hovedfag i engelsk, fransk og spansk og mindrearbeid i kulturstudier. Ved å blande sin lidenskap for språk og litteratur med sin kjærlighet til teknologi, bruker han sin ferdighet til å skrive om teknologi, spill og øke bevisstheten om personvern og sikkerhet.

Mer fra Toin Villar

Abonner på vårt nyhetsbrev

Bli med i vårt nyhetsbrev for tekniske tips, anmeldelser, gratis ebøker og eksklusive tilbud!

Klikk her for å abonnere